Columbus Short continues to play himself, yet has managed to finesse the system. The former Scandal actor served only 34 days of a 1-year jail sentence for beating his wife.
Reports Page Six:
The LA County Sheriff’s Department didn’t give a reason for Short’s early release.
The former “Scandal” star pleaded no contest to the charge last November, when he was sentenced to 36 months of probation; however, Short was already on probation from a previous run-in with the law that saw him knock a man out in a bar fight, so he was sentenced to a year behind bars.
Short began his sentence Feb. 13 but was released Monday from Los Angeles County Jail.
